one. Introduction to URL Shortening
URL shortening is a way on the Internet wherein a long URL might be converted into a shorter, far more workable kind. This shortened URL redirects to the first long URL when frequented. Companies like Bitly and TinyURL are very well-known samples of URL shorteners. The need for URL shortening arose with the advent of social media marketing platforms like Twitter, where by character boundaries for posts manufactured it tough to share lengthy URLs.

Past social media, URL shorteners are handy in marketing strategies, email messages, and printed media wherever extended URLs is often cumbersome.

2. Main Factors of a URL Shortener
A URL shortener ordinarily is made up of the following components:

World-wide-web Interface: This can be the entrance-end aspect where by users can enter their extensive URLs and get shortened variations. It may be a simple type on a Web content.
Database: A database is necessary to retail outlet the mapping in between the initial prolonged URL and also the shortened Edition. Databases like MySQL, PostgreSQL, or NoSQL solutions like MongoDB can be used.
Redirection Logic: Here is the backend logic that takes the small URL and redirects the user for the corresponding extensive URL. This logic will likely be applied in the web server or an software layer.
API: Many URL shorteners give an API so that third-party programs can programmatically shorten URLs and retrieve the original long URLs.
3. Planning the URL Shortening Algorithm
The crux of a URL shortener lies in its algorithm for converting a long URL into a short just one. A number of techniques is usually employed, for instance:

Hashing: The very long URL can be hashed into a hard and fast-size string, which serves because the limited URL. On the other hand, hash collisions (distinctive URLs causing exactly the same hash) have to be managed.
Base62 Encoding: Just one popular approach is to work with Base62 encoding (which takes advantage of sixty two figures: 0-nine, A-Z, and also a-z) on an integer ID. The ID corresponds into the entry during the databases. This process makes sure that the quick URL is as limited as is possible.
Random String Era: Yet another technique is usually to create a random string of a set duration (e.g., six figures) and Test if it’s by now in use from the database. If not, it’s assigned on the extensive URL.
4. Databases Management
The database schema for a URL shortener is usually easy, with two Main fields:

ID: A novel identifier for every URL entry.
Extensive URL: The first URL that needs to be shortened.
Small URL/Slug: The quick version of your URL, normally saved as a unique string.
In addition to these, you may want to retailer metadata including the generation day, expiration day, and the quantity of instances the limited URL is accessed.

5. Dealing with Redirection
Redirection is actually a critical Section of the URL shortener's operation. Every time a user clicks on a brief URL, the assistance should quickly retrieve the initial URL in the databases and redirect the user employing an HTTP 301 (long term redirect) or 302 (momentary redirect) position code.

Overall performance is essential right here, as the procedure needs to be virtually instantaneous. Methods like databases indexing and caching (e.g., utilizing Redis or Memcached) is often employed to speed up the retrieval system.

6. Stability Factors
Protection is a significant problem in URL shorteners:

Destructive URLs: A URL shortener is usually abused to spread malicious inbound links. Utilizing URL validation, blacklisting, or integrating with third-get together protection expert services to check URLs prior to shortening them can mitigate this threat.
Spam Prevention: Level restricting and CAPTCHA can avoid abuse by spammers endeavoring to generate A huge number of limited URLs.
seven. Scalability
As being the URL shortener grows, it might have to manage many URLs and redirect requests. This requires a scalable architecture, perhaps involving load balancers, distributed databases, and microservices.

Load Balancing: Distribute targeted traffic throughout numerous servers to manage significant masses.
Distributed Databases: Use databases that could scale horizontally, like Cassandra or MongoDB.
Microservices: Individual worries like URL shortening, analytics, and redirection into diverse companies to enhance scalability and maintainability.
8. Analytics
URL shorteners often provide analytics to trace how often a short URL is clicked, where the traffic is coming from, and various handy metrics. This calls for logging Each and every redirect and possibly integrating with analytics platforms.
